nomodeset allowed me to install the driver manually, and everything seemed to go fine. When I rebooted, I got a message (tried to copy, but seems I lost it) that the nvidea driver did not exist, and would I like to boot in low graphics mode.

EDIT: after running nvidia-xconfig again, I rebooted and got the same message. took a picture of it, so here is what it says:
Code: Select all
The following error was encountered. You may need to update your configuration to solve this.

[EE] NVIDIA: Failed to load the NVIDIA kernel module.
Please check your
[EE] NVIDIA:   system's kernel log for additional error messages.
[EE] Failed to load module "nvidia" (module-specific error)
[EE] No drivers available.

by gjringo
You (or the installing program) have to update grub after each installation of graphics drivers.(otherwise your system is trying to boot with grub still using its old configuration not yet being aware of the new driver installation.)
Open terminal and type this:

sudo update-grub and reboot. You may have to also run nvidia-xconfig in terminal to get the correct display for your card

by wolf3491
Yes. this is what I have done:
add nomodeset to grub, boot, ctrl + alt + f1, stop gdm, install driver, reboot, error message.
run nvidia-xconfig, reboot, error message.
purged nvidia*, reinstalled driver, nvidia xconfig, reboot, same error message.
update grub, reboot, same error message.
